How much do manufacturing assembly j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for manufacturing assembly in Kansas is $16.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.13 and $17.36 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is manufacturing assembly?

Manufacturing assembly refers to the process of putting together individual components or parts to create a finished product, typically in a factory or production line setting. Assemblers may work with machinery, tools, and manual techniques to connect, fasten, or assemble parts according to blueprints or specifications. The job often requires attention to detail, the ability to follow instructions, and teamwork to ensure quality and efficiency. Manufacturing assembly is essential in industries like automotive, electronics, and consumer goods, where products are made from many separate pieces.

What is the difference between Manufacturing Assembly vs Manufacturing Technician?

AspectManufacturing AssemblyManufacturing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job trainingHigh school diploma or equivalent; technical certification often preferred
Work EnvironmentFactories, assembly lines, production floorsFactories, testing labs, maintenance areas
Job FocusAssembling products and componentsMaintaining, troubleshooting, and testing manufacturing equipment
Common UsageUsed in assembly line roles across manufacturing industriesUsed in roles requiring technical skills for equipment operation and maintenance

Manufacturing Assembly primarily involves assembling products on the production line, focusing on putting components together. Manufacturing Technicians often handle equipment maintenance, troubleshooting, and testing to ensure smooth manufacturing processes. While both roles work in manufacturing environments, their responsibilities and required skills differ, with assembly roles emphasizing manual assembly and technician roles emphasizing technical maintenance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Manufacturing Assembly Worker,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manufacturing Assembly Worker, you need strong manual dexterity, attention to detail, and a high school diploma or equivalent as a baseline qualification. Familiarity with assembly line machinery, hand tools, and basic safety certifications like OSHA are commonly required. Teamwork, reliability, and effective communication are essential soft skills that help maintain workflow and resolve issues quickly. These skills ensure products are assembled accurately and efficiently, contributing to overall production quality and workplace safety.

What are some common challenges faced in a manufacturing assembly role and how can they be overcome?

One common challenge in manufacturing assembly is maintaining high accuracy and speed while adhering to strict quality standards. Workers may also face repetitive tasks, which can lead to fatigue or minor errors over time. To overcome these challenges, it's important to take regular breaks, follow standardized procedures, and communicate proactively with team members and supervisors. Additionally, continuous training and cross-training can help improve efficiency and reduce mistakes, fostering a supportive work environment.

Job description

Job Summary The Asse mbly Mechanic is responsible for assembling, installing, sealing, rigging, inspecting, and completing precision structural and system components. This role requires working from drawings, process specifications, and quality control requirements to ensure assemblies meet fit, form, and function standards. Mechanics also perform functional testing, minor machine maintenance, and support continuous product flow within the manufacturing process. Key Responsibilities A ssemble and install components using drawings, documents, and specifications Perform functional testing to verify fit, form, and function Use shop mathematics and precision measuring/test instruments to complete assignments Utilize tooling in the assembly of sub-assemblies and end items Verify work against engineering specifications and identify discrepancies Perform minor machine maintenance including filter replacement, lubrication, and coolant checks Move product within the manufacturing area using assigned equipment Support continuous product flow by assisting and training employees at all levels Cross-train in inspection and become SIA qualified Operate fastening equipment including conventional and CNC machines (less than simultaneous 3-axis movement) Perform specialty skills such as: Assembly/Installation of Structures Sealer Application Sub-Assembly Doors Installation Integral Fuel Cell Sealing Precision Bench Assembly Pressure and Vacuum Testing Required Qualifications 11+ years of experience (10 years considered) Fuselage integration expertise Multilayer layup experience 737 aircraft experience required Preferred Qualifications A dvanced knowledge of aerospace assembly processes Experience mentoring and training assembly personnel Familiarity with inspection and quality assurance procedur es Education: High School or equivalent
